8-FLUOROADENOSINE

Base Information
  • Chemical Name:8-FLUOROADENOSINE
  • CAS No.:23205-67-6
  • Molecular Formula:C10H12FN5O4
  • Molecular Weight:285.235
  • Hs Code.:
  • Mol file:23205-67-6.mol
8-FLUOROADENOSINE

Synonyms:8-Fluoroadenosine;NSC 341925

Chemical Property of 8-FLUOROADENOSINE
Chemical Property:
  • Vapor Pressure:2.32E-20mmHg at 25°C 
  • Boiling Point:696.5°Cat760mmHg 
  • PKA:12.88±0.70(Predicted) 
  • Flash Point:375°C 
  • PSA:139.54000 
  • Density:2.17g/cm3 
  • LogP:-1.25970

Useful:
  • Uses The first non-enzymic synthesis of 8-Fluoroadenosine was described. The intermediate generation of 8-?fluoroadenosines as a tool to increase the reaction rates of nucleophilic substitutions was briefly examined.
